4:9 And when the living creatures give glory and honor and thanks to Him who sits on the throne, to Him who lives forever and ever,

And when the LIVING CREATURES give GLORY

This is a switch -- we come short of the glory of God, Romans 3:23; certainly present suffering pales compared to future glory, Romans 8:18-22; we are being transformed, 2 Corinthians 3:17-18; and Christ will be glorified in us in that day, a glory of His power, 2 Thessalonians 1:9.

and HONOR

Part of the awesomeness of God demands HONOR, 1 Timothy 6:13-16. We must HONOR both the Son and the Father, John 5:22-23.

and THANKS

Consider that these living creatures have never "fallen from grace", so what are they THANKing Him for. Since it is not for redemption, it must be for the privilege to serve Him.
